Katherine’s Favorites
2008 – a new KF’s unplugged (live) is going to be recorded… daily rehearsals…
2007 – KF turns 15! New album “Break The Ice” is recorded by the original cast, and released in early December 2007. The band is putting together a conccert show “Break The Ice”.
2006 – KF is touring Russia with a compilation show “While In Russia”.
2005 – KF is working on a multimedia musical “Krasnaya Strela” (“Red Arrow”). This is KF’s first big project in Russian. A new song “Your Turn Now” is recorded and a music video released. The song becomes #1 in Russia’s Music Top.
2003 – a new single “Ozone” is recorded and released at Tutti Records (Ekaterinburg, Russia).
2002 – the band is working on a new project “Ozone”. Unplugged version is performed at music clubs and concert halls throughout Russia.
2001 – music video “I Got The Rain To Come” is produced by Ildar Ziganshin, a well-known Russian photographer and cinematographer.
2000 – a new album “Back To Reality” is released by Tutti Records. “Katherine’s Favorites” continues to perform at the best music venues in Ekaterinburg (Russia).
1999 – KF appears on an hour long radio music program on Pilot FM Radio. The band is invited to participate in the number of local and national music festivals.
1998 – the band is selected to participate in Radio France International Music Contest ‘98 (Paris, France).
1997 – a new album “The Women We Left” is recorded and released at EnFace Records (Ekaterinburg, Russia). KF’s first single in Russian “Hi!” is released.
1995 – a new album “New Life Was Still Going On Around” is recorded and released at EnFace Tutti Records. The band successfully tours Switzerland and gets a lot of attention from European press and audience.
1993 – a single “Quiet Melody #17” is released at “Studio 8” (Ekaterinburg). The group gets Grand Prix of the prestigeous annual Live Sound Festival (Nizhnii Tagil, Russia.
1992 – “Katherine’s Favorites” forms and record its first composition “She Loves Me Alone” at Nautilus Pompilius Studio (Ekaterinburg, Russia).
